What to Expect on Friday Nights

Kids begin the gathering with everyone in the main room.

We worship together as a full family and take a moment for Kids Prayer Time, a special part of our service to bless and acknowledge the children among us.

After that, kids are invited to head upstairs to their own space – safe, welcoming room right above the sanctuary.

Yes, we often see their little faces peeking through the curtains, and we love it.

What Happens Upstairs

Each week, our kids engage in:

  • A Bible-based lesson that walks through the story of God
  • A creative craft or hands-on activity to help them engage the story
  • Encouragement, fun, and care from trusted leaders who know how to help kids feel at home

Whether your child is full of questions, shy at first, or bouncing with energy – we’re ready to welcome them.

Safety & Support

We take your child’s saftey seriously. Here’s what we offer.

  • Background-checked volunteers with years of experience
  • Led by a husband-wife team, including a retired pastor and children’s ministry veteran.
  • Familiarity with autism, sensory needs, and diverse challenges
  • The freedom for parents to keep kids with them during the gathering if they prefer

We currently have a small group of kids, and our size allows us to give personal attention and care to each one.
